how do you make the colours look so realistic? do you start in black and white or with colours right away?

👍: 0 ⏩: 1

YannickBouchard In reply to Hyoko-x3 [2011-07-24 00:18:47 +0000 UTC]

I use colors right away. I pretty much work my digital paintings the way I'd do with oils. I block the background with a median colors, then I do the dark areas, higlights, then more details and middle tones to blend the zones, and details and texture at last. With digital it's easier cause I always work with reference pictures, so I can use the colors directly from the reference image.
